Had this just come in and I don't bank with them :-))


Dear Santander online customer,

Your account is suspended due to multiple number
of incorrect login attempts.

For your protection, we've suspended your account.

To reactivate your login access please download the
form attached to your e-mail and confirm your details.

Note: If not completed until October 19, 2011,
we will be forced to suspend your account.

Thank you,
Customer Support Service.


Bank Accounts, Savings, Loans and Mortgages: Santander
